Well, AT-PTs are more stable than the AT-STs, because they have thicker and shorter legs. This makes them slower, unfortunately, but it is less likely to fall over. The command pod can be raised or lowered, they can carry two passengers (in an emergency! The command pod is cramped.), and they have primitive sensors. Their weapons are twin lasers and a concussion grenade launcher.
